To me it was amazing, how a rust based solution could cover almost much xournalpp can do and even better in many aspect. Rnote is sleep and even run smoother. Xournalpp, has been working on its next generation xml file format to include media in the file, but rnote has that feature just out of the box at early releases. I still have both at hands and try to support both, but I have been gravitated more and more toward Rnote in recent weeks.

Plus, rnote supports infinite canvas and better stylus support on top of better UI.

This being said, xournalpp has been around for longer time and it's a bit more mature. Also, at least currently, it has better PDF annotation support.
